import {useEffect, useMemo, useRef, useState} from 'react';
import {useDomScale} from '@/react/context/dom-scale.js';
import {useRadians} from '@/react/context/radians.js';
import {RESOLUTION} from '@/util/constants.js';
import {render} from '@/util/dialogue.js';
import DialogueCaret from './dialogue-caret.jsx';
import styles from './dialogue.module.css';
export default function Dialogue({
camera,
dialogue,
scale,
}) {
const domScale = useDomScale();
const ref = useRef();
const [dimensions, setDimensions] = useState({h: 0, w: 0});
const [caret, setCaret] = useState(0);
const radians = useRadians();
useEffect(() => {
return dialogue.addSkipListener(() => {
if (caret >= dialogue.letters.length - 1) {
dialogue.onClose();
}
else {
setCaret(dialogue.letters.length - 1);
}
});
}, [caret, dialogue]);
useEffect(() => {
const {params} = dialogue.letters[caret];
let handle;
if (caret >= dialogue.letters.length - 1) {
const {linger} = dialogue;
if (!linger) {
return;
}
handle = setTimeout(() => {
dialogue.onClose();
}, linger * 1000);
}
else {
let jump = caret;
while (0 === dialogue.letters[jump].params.rate.frequency && jump < dialogue.letters.length - 1) {
jump += 1;
}
setCaret(jump);
if (jump < dialogue.letters.length - 1) {
handle = setTimeout(() => {
setCaret(caret + 1);
}, params.rate.frequency * 1000)
}
}
return () => {
clearTimeout(handle);
}
}, [caret, dialogue]);
useEffect(() => {
let handle;
function track() {
if (ref.current) {
const {height, width} = ref.current.getBoundingClientRect();
setDimensions({h: height / domScale, w: width / domScale});
}
handle = requestAnimationFrame(track);
}
handle = requestAnimationFrame(track);
return () => {
cancelAnimationFrame(handle);
};
}, [dialogue, domScale, ref]);
const localRender = useMemo(
() => render(dialogue.letters, styles.letter),
[dialogue.letters],
);
let position = 'function' === typeof dialogue.position
? dialogue.position()
: dialogue.position || {x: 0, y: 0};
position = {
x: position.x + dialogue.offset.x,
y: position.y + dialogue.offset.y,
};
const bounds = {
x: dimensions.w / (2 * scale),
y: dimensions.h / (2 * scale),
};
const left = Math.max(
Math.min(
position.x * scale - camera.x,
RESOLUTION.x - bounds.x * scale - 16,
),
bounds.x * scale + 16,
);
const top = Math.max(
Math.min(
position.y * scale - camera.y,
RESOLUTION.y - bounds.y * scale - 16,
),
bounds.y * scale + 16,
);
return (
<div
className={styles.dialogue}
ref={ref}
style={{
left: `${left}px`,
top: `${top}px`,
}}
>
<DialogueCaret
camera={camera}
dialogue={dialogue}
dimensions={dimensions}
scale={scale}
/>
<p className={styles.letters}>
{localRender(caret, radians)}
</p>
</div>
);
}
